Shoe Dini Video Review

As we get older, many of us suffer from back pains or arthritis, making it difficult to do simple things such as bending over just to put on our shoes.  With the Shoe Dini, you get the reach you need without straining to bend over since the device has a telescopic handle that locks in place.  Additionally, unlike other shoe horns, the Shoe Dini has a clip on the back of the shoe horn that helps to hold your shoe in place while you try to put your foot into it, or to assist you in removing your shoes.  StarReviews took the time to test the versatility of the Shoe Dini to see if it really does what it claims.

With the Shoe Dini, you will receive an easy to assemble two piece product that consists of the shoe horn with a built-in clip to hold down your shoes, and the telescopic handle that easily screws together.  The attached clip is wide enough to even fit over the backs of athletic shoes and thin enough to use it with women’s heeled shoes, so you can virtually use it with any shoe.  The telescopic handle gives you about a three foot reach when fully extended.

During our test, we used a basic slip on shoe.  We were able to reach our shoe with no problem, and the clip slipped over the back of the shoe with ease.  The clip held our shoe in place and allowed for us to easily put on our shoes.  To remove our shoes, we put the shoe horn clip back over our shoes and pushed down with the locking mechanism to remove our shoes.  Although the infomercial states that you are able to pick up your shoe using the Shoe Dini, we were unable to do so.

Pros:

  • Great product that does extend to the full three feet as promised, to prevent bending over and back strain
  • The clip works great in assisting with holding down your shoes to put them on or take them off

Cons:

  • Infomercial stretches the truth about the product picking up your shoes for you, as this is not something we were able to do during our real life test of the Shoe Dini

Overall, the Shoe Dini receives 4 out of 6 stars from StarReviews for being a great product. However, the infomercial did stretch the truth about the product giving you the ability to pick up your shoes without bending over, so we couldn’t give it a full six stars.
